Chick-fil-A New Year’s Eve hours at a glance
Chick-fil-A typically closes early on New Year’s Eve, usually around 6:00 p.m. local time, and many locations are closed on January 1. Because hours can vary by market and individual franchise ownership, the most reliable way to confirm whether a specific restaurant is open is to check the store page on the Chick-fil-A website or use the Chick-fil-A app.

Corporate policy vs. franchise discretion
Chick-fil-A corporate communications typically do not publish a single companywide holiday schedule. Instead, each franchise operator manages store hours within corporate guidelines. This means that even stores in the same city may differ in whether they open at all on New Year’s Eve. Corporate guidelines emphasize associate availability, local traffic patterns, and operational feasibility when approving reduced schedules.
